### MCP Events
- **MCPConnectionStartedEvent**: Emitted when starting to connect to an MCP server. Contains the server name, URL, transport type, connection timeout, and whether it's a reconnection attempt.
- **MCPConnectionCompletedEvent**: Emitted when successfully connected to an MCP server. Contains the server name, connection duration in milliseconds, and whether it was a reconnection.
- **MCPConnectionFailedEvent**: Emitted when connection to an MCP server fails. Contains the server name, error message, and error type (`timeout`, `authentication`, `network`, etc.).
- **MCPToolExecutionStartedEvent**: Emitted when starting to execute an MCP tool. Contains the server name, tool name, and tool arguments.
- **MCPToolExecutionCompletedEvent**: Emitted when MCP tool execution completes successfully. Contains the server name, tool name, result, and execution duration in milliseconds.
- **MCPToolExecutionFailedEvent**: Emitted when MCP tool execution fails. Contains the server name, tool name, error message, and error type (`timeout`, `validation`, `server_error`, etc.).
- **MCPConfigFetchFailedEvent**: Emitted when fetching an MCP server configuration fails (e.g., the MCP is not connected in your account, API error, or connection failure after config was fetched). Contains the slug, error message, and error type (`not_connected`, `api_error`, `connection_failed`).
